Output 8bd7089b77fe36b66ed3bff5c052f2d9aa52b21e6382b8d4522f7419ce46f9bc:5

value
25601305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 126854d096455fe305583aee287a2a7a48fab0d5 OP_EQUAL
address
M9aVNx2KbqfjLmomANzQu9Q8Vnjezhuhxm
transaction
8bd7089b77fe36b66ed3bff5c052f2d9aa52b21e6382b8d4522f7419ce46f9bc
spent
true